Pittsburgh Steelers (http://sports.yahoo.com/nfl/teams/pit/) veteran wide receiver Hines Ward loves to play the villain.
And he gloated a little bit after the Steelers' 31-24 AFC divisional playoff victory at Heinz Field, rubbing some salt in the Baltimore Ravens (http://sports.yahoo.com/nfl/teams/bal/)' wounds.
"They always pride themselves on bullying guys, bullying people," Ward said. "They always do all the trash-talking. They have been trash-talking all week, how they want to break Ben's nose again and stuff like that. Sometimes when you are fighting the bully, you just have to hit them in the mouth and you shut them up.
"To come back the way we did, the way we fought throughout the whole game, speaks volumes about our team, what we are made of and what type of character we are. It was a great win for our organization."
It got ugly between two fierce rivals Saturday night.
Ward slammed free safety Ed Reed (http://sports.yahoo.com/nfl/players/5910/)(notes) (http://sports.yahoo.com/nfl/players/5910/news) to the ground in the first quarter and was penalized for unnecessary roughness.
Ward said he was outnumbered and defending himself.
"I got a roughness call and I had four guys beating me up," Ward said . "I love it. That's what it is all about. Ed Reed and I have our battles, no disrespect to Ed. He probably thinks it's a little personal, but it's playoffs. Loser goes home. So why sit there and save it? I am going to go out there and fight, scratch, and claw to win a ballgame."
